Tamale Boyz is Tulsa's legendary home of the Fried Tamale, located on historic Route 66 in southwest Tulsa. Founded by Abel Murrieta Ruiz, whose journey began as a teenager selling tamales from a car, then a snow cone shack, then a food truck before opening their beloved brick-and-mortar restaurant in 2022, Tamale Boyz is a true Tulsa success story. Every tamale is handcrafted using traditional recipes passed down through generations, and the menu is packed with authentic Mexican favorites including birria tacos, street tacos, chilaquiles, protein bowls, and the famous fried tamale smothered in mozzarella and nacho cheese. Originally built in 1949 and opened May 5, 1950, the Tee Pee Drive-In is a beloved historic drive-in theater on Sapulpa's stretch of Historic Route 66, just minutes from Tulsa. After closing in 1999, new owners completely restored and reopened it in April 2023 with a full renovation including a new screen, rock climbing area, retro playground, and concession trailers serving burgers, hot dogs, popcorn, and craft cocktails. Two vintage Spartan trailers are available as Airbnb overnight stays, decked out in retro style with full kitchenettes, bathrooms, and WiFi. Wednesday nights are $10 per carload, and themed movie nights with custom cocktails make every visit an unforgettable experience. Dogs are welcome on leash. A true Route 66 gem where nostalgia lives. TGI Promo is a Tulsa-based Cherokee woman-owned promotional products and custom apparel company founded in 1990 by CEO Tracy Copeland, a division of TGI Enterprises Inc. which employs 58 full-time staff and serves clients across the nation including numerous Native American tribes and top Greek organizations. Known for high-quality screen printing, embroidery, graphic design, and merchandise planning, TGI Promo also curates a thoughtful collection of Oklahoma, Tulsa, and Route 66 branded merchandise available through their retail booth inside Meadow Gold Mack's Route 66 Outpost at 1306 E 11th Street in Tulsa's Meadow Gold District. The company has collaborated with iconic Tulsa brands including Marshall Brewing Co. and Cain's Ballroom, designing celebrated merchandise collections for the historic Cain's centennial, and continues to expand its community presence through events and creative local partnerships. The Bama Companies, Inc. is a legendary Tulsa-based family-owned food manufacturing company with roots going back to 1927 when founder Cornelia Alabama "Bama" Marshall began baking pies in her Texas kitchen, before her son Paul Marshall relocated the business to Tulsa, Oklahoma in 1937. Today led by CEO Paula Marshall, Bama has grown into a global bakery powerhouse supplying handcrafted pies, biscuits, buns, pizza dough, pie shells, and frozen dough products to some of the world's largest restaurant chains including McDonald's, Pizza Hut, and Taco Bell across more than 20 countries. The company operates manufacturing facilities in the United States and abroad, including plants in Beijing and Guangzhou, China, and boasts a pie production line capable of producing 1,400 pies per minute. A recipient of the prestigious Malcolm Baldrige National Quality Award and a certified B-Corp, Bama is deeply rooted in Tulsa's community and has been a cornerstone of Route 66 history with a commemorative historical marker on East 11th Street.
